Emre Can and Philippe Coutinho returned to Liverpool action on Sunday afternoon, making appearances for the Under-21 side, who were beaten 2-0 by FC Porto.

The young pair were late returning to Liverpool's pre-season, after busy summer's where each featured internationally, for Germany and Brazil respectively.

International duty

Coutinho featured for the Selecao as they reached the quarter finals of the Copa America, where they were defeated on penalties by Peru in a similar fashion to their 2011 exit from the competition.

Can played a starring role for Germany as they marched through the UEFA European Under-21 Championship Group Stages, but couldn't prevent them losing 5-0 to Portugal in the semi finals, admitting that his side thought they were better than they were and had too much confidence.

These international exploits saw them, along with new Liverpool signing Roberto Firmino, allowed an extended holiday to get the same break that their teammates got. Firmino played alongside Coutinho at the Copa and scored in the tournament, but wasn't involved against Porto.

No triumph for Liverpool

Unfortunately for Michael Beale's young side, they went down 2-0 to a strong an athletic Porto side, as Coutinho and Can both featured for the first 45 minutes in the Steel Park Cup.

The young Reds couldn't prove victorious in the tournament, with PSV Eindhoven the eventual champions. After a 3-3 draw with the Merseyside side on Saturday, PSV beat Corby Town 3-0 on Sunday to take the trophy.

A thankful manager

Manager Beale, who VAVEL spoke exclusively to last week, praised the senior pair for their efforts, saying: "It was fantastic to have Philippe and Emre with us and they did really well in the planned 45 minute outing.

"Their attitude was absolutely fantastic and they were brilliant in the dressing room as well with our young lads."

The under-21's begin their season with a home match against Chelsea in less than two weeks time, with the senior side getting their's up and running with a match away at Stoke City just a day later.
